The Vierz Centre Party (Vierz: Vierze Zentrumspartei, VZP), also known as Zentrum ("Centre"), is a centrist, agrarian political party in Vierzland. While the party's strength has fluctuated over time, it has consistently been the third or fourth largest in the country, and performs particularly well in local and state elections in the country's southwest. Klemens Brandt has led the party since 2012.
